Iron Maiden is known for their extravagant stage performances in heavy metal, but you may want to reconsider recording any moments during their forthcoming European “Run for Your Lives Tour.” In comments from their longtime manager Rod Smallwood, the band is requesting that fans “greatly reduce” phone usage at the upcoming shows.
“We genuinely want fans to soak in the experience live, rather than through their small screens,” Smallwood stated in a post on the band’s official website. “The current level of phone usage detracts from the enjoyment, especially for the band who see a sea of phones in the audience, and for fellow concertgoers as well.”
